Suppose I have the following class with the following member functions:


namespace gui
{
	class ChainedAnimations
	{
	private:
		std::vector<Sprite*> m_sprites;
		bool m_paused;
		u32 m_activeSprite;

	public:
		ChainedAnimations();
		~ChainedAnimations();

		void Tick();
		void Draw( RenderContext& rc );
		void Reset();
		void Pause();
		void Resume();
	};
}


Lets say that I've went through all of the member function prototypes in this class, top to bottom, and used "Create Implementation" on each. In the CPP file we'll have empty function implementations for each member function prototype, all in order as they appear in the header.

Now, take the same class with one added member function (bolded below):


namespace gui
{
	class ChainedAnimations
	{
	private:
		std::vector<Sprite*> m_sprites;
		bool m_paused;
		u32 m_activeSprite;

	public:
		ChainedAnimations();
		~ChainedAnimations();

		void Tick();
		void Draw( RenderContext& rc );
		void Reset();
		void AddSprite( Sprite* spr );
		void Pause();
		void Resume();
	};
}


When I use "Create Implementation" on the new, bolded prototype above, the implementation should be placed in the CPP file below the implementation for "Reset()" but above the implementation for "Pause()". It would be nice if visual assist would sort these implementations for me, as I create them.

There are instances, however, where one programmer may attempt to "organize" the prototypes in the class. It would be nice to be able to open a refactoring menu over the class name in the header file and select something like "Sort Implementations" which would go to the CPP file and sort the implementations as they appear in the header.

This seems like an incredibly difficult feature to support, so I understand if you guys can't do it. But it's just a cool idea I thought I'd share.

The current idea is to produce a dialog listing the existing methods, and you select the function you want the new implementation or declaration to go after.

Sequential sounds reasonable, but it assumes that the header and cpp file are currently in the same order. When you start working on existing code we cannot make this assumption, so this is not going to work very well

Currently VA does try to group overloads together, and classes together, which is a start.

Sorting, or just re-ordering the implementations in a cpp file has come up before, but personally I am very wary of this idea, since it is so hard to define an "implementation". The actual block of code is clear enough, but what about associated comment blocks? If you jumble up the code and the comments you will end up with quite a mess, but there is no obvious and reliable method for VA to understand what comment is associated with which implementation.

Sorting might actually invalidate working code. For instance if the implementation file contains #define statements in between, or #ifdef blocks, automatically sorting parts of the code might lead to something that doesn't compile - or worse: it does compile to something different than intended.

Even if there are no preprocessor directives, typedefs and declarations in the middle of an implementation file might cause compiler errors if implementations are moved above them. Of course, those declarations shouldn't be there in the first place, but never make assumptions on existing code. As a matter of fact, Bjarne Stroustrup himself suggested the practice of putting declarations right at the position where they are needed, and not at the top!
